游乐游手机版
首页/网络安全/文章详情

Linux横向移动加密技术的全面解析与实战操作

时间:2026-06-15 07:12
在Linux操作系统中进行文件或目录的横向迁移时,保障数据传输的安全性至关重要。一种高效且可靠的方法是将rsync命令与ssh协议结合使用,实现加密传输。整个过程可以清晰地分解为几个关键步骤。 第一步:生成SSH密钥对 首先,打开你的终端。如果你还没有用于身份验证的SSH密钥对,需要先创建一套。使用

在Linux操作系统中进行文件或目录的横向迁移时,保障数据传输的安全性至关重要。一种高效且可靠的方法是将rsync命令与ssh协议结合使用,实现加密传输。整个过程可以清晰地分解为几个关键步骤。

linux横向移动怎样加密

第一步:生成SSH密钥对

首先,打开你的终端。如果你还没有用于身份验证的SSH密钥对,需要先创建一套。使用ssh-keygen命令即可轻松完成:

ssh-keygen -t rsa -b 4096 -C “your_email@example.com”

执行该命令后,按照屏幕提示操作即可。你可以选择接受默认的密钥保存路径,也可以指定一个自定义位置。

第二步:配置远程服务器公钥认证

接下来,需要让远程服务器信任你的本地机器。这通过将本地生成的公钥(默认位于~/.ssh/id_rsa.pub)添加到远程服务器的授权列表中来实现。一个非常便捷的命令是ssh-copy-id

ssh-copy-id user@remote_host

这里,将user替换为你在远程服务器上的用户名,remote_host替换为服务器的地址(IP或域名)。这个命令会自动帮你完成公钥的追加工作,省去手动编辑的麻烦。

第三步:使用rsync进行加密传输

完成认证配置后,就可以开始安全的文件移动了。rsync命令的强大之处在于其高效性和灵活性。假设你需要将本地的/path/to/local_directory目录同步到远程服务器的/path/to/remote_directory,可以使用如下命令:

rsync -a vz --delete /path/to/local_directory/ user@remote_host:/path/to/remote_directory/

解释一下这几个常用选项:-a代表归档模式,能够保持文件属性(如权限、时间戳等);-v输出详细信息,让你实时看到传输进度;-z在传输过程中进行压缩,以节省带宽;--delete则会删除目标目录中存在而源目录中已没有的文件,确保两端完全同步。通过以上步骤,你便成功借助SSH的加密通道和rsync的高效同步能力,在Linux系统间完成了安全的横向文件迁移。

来源:https://www.yisu.com/ask/8331872.html
上一篇Thrift与HBase加密功能是否支持 下一篇ZooKeeper Digest加密步骤详解
本站内容用于信息整理与展示,如有侵权或内容问题请及时联系处理。

相关推荐

补充同频道和同主题内容,方便继续浏览更多相关内容。

同类最新

继续查看同栏目最近更新的文章。

更多
Linux上MinIO数据加密配置与使用方法
网络安全 · 2026-06-25

Linux上MinIO数据加密配置与使用方法

MinIO本身并未直接内建数据加密功能,但无需担心,这并不意味着无法实现。在实际部署中,可通过挂载外部加密工具或启用企业版内置加密来满足合规要求。以下两种方案,覆盖了从开源到商业化的主流实施路径。 借助mSeal实现文件系统级透明加密 mSeal是一套开源项目,能够在Linux上提供透明加密机制——

Ubuntu系统Swap分区加密方法详解
网络安全 · 2026-06-25

Ubuntu系统Swap分区加密方法详解

在Ubuntu中,交换分区无法直接进行加密,但可通过关闭交换分区、使用LUKS加密整个磁盘或分区等,或将交换文件置于加密文件系统中来间接地实现保护。需要特别注意的是,这些操作有可能会影响系统性能。

Ubuntu系统漏洞检测实用方法
网络安全 · 2026-06-25

Ubuntu系统漏洞检测实用方法

检测Ubuntu漏洞需综合运用自动化工具与手动检查。常用工具包括Nmap、Metasploit、SQLMap、Wireshark和Snort,用于扫描网络、渗透测试、检测SQL注入及监控流量。同时应定期更新系统和软件,并检查系统配置以减少攻击面,关注官方安全公告。

Linux telnet会话加密方法详解
网络安全 · 2026-06-25

Linux telnet会话加密方法详解

Telnet以明文传输数据,存在严重安全隐患。SSH协议通过建立加密隧道替代Telnet,保障远程登录安全。安装OpenSSH并配置相关参数,使用ssh命令发起加密连接,即可实现安全的远程操作。SSH采用公钥加密和会话密钥确保机密性,并支持端口转发等功能,有效防止中间人攻击。

Ubuntu Tomcat安全防护与防攻击设置方法
网络安全 · 2026-06-25

Ubuntu Tomcat安全防护与防攻击设置方法

在Ubuntu部署Tomcat需提前做好安全配置:清理默认应用、使用低权限用户、移除不必要组件、关闭自动部署、修改默认密码、限制管理界面访问、启用账户锁定、保持版本更新、设置文件权限、使用UFW防火墙、持续监控运行状态。